JOHN INYANG OKORO(delivering the leading judgment): In the High Court of Justice, Rivers State, holden at Port Harcourt (Coram) W. A. Chechey, J, the Plaintiffs who are the Respondents in this appeal, on 12th of November, 2003 by a motion ex-parte dated and filed on the 30th day of September, 2003, sought and obtained leave of the said Court to maintain the suit, the subject matter of this appeal in a representative capacity for themselves and as representing the members of Ibotirem Town, Andoni, excluding the Defendants who are the Appellants. Pursuant to the said leave they filed a statement of claim containing 35 paragraphs and claimed thus:-
Wherefore the Plaintiffs claim against the defendants jointly and severally as follows:-
(a) A declaration that the 1st plaintiff is the Okan-Ama of Ibotirem Town, Andoni, having been properly selected, presented and installed the Okan-Ama of Ibotirem Town by the Ibotirem Town.
